Assassin’s Creed Valhalla: Dawn of Ragnarok Will Cost $40

It's been confirmed that the newly announced expansion will not be part of Assassin's Creed Valhalla's season pass.

Following a number of leaks, yesterday, Ubisoft officially unveiled Assassin’s Creed Valhalla: Dawn of Ragnarokthe next expansion for the massive action RPG. Diving head-on into the more mythological aspects of the experience, it’s being billed as the most ambitious expansion in the series’ history. With that in mind, how much cash are you going to have to shell out?

As per the expansion’s PlayStation Store pageDawn of Ragnarok will cost $40. As you may have expected, it will not be included in Assassin’s Creed Valhalla’s season pass. The season pass, of course, was also going to include only the two expansions that released for the game in 2021 – Wrath of the Druids and The Siege of Paris – and year 2 content was not announced as being included. In fact, back when the season pass was unveiled, Ubisoft hadn’t even announced that the game would receive any content beyond its first year, so this doesn’t come as much of a surprise.

Of course, both Assassin’s Creed Odyssey and Valhalla have also received new free content with crossover story quests featuring the protagonists from both games. Read more on that through here.

Assassin’s Creed Valhalla: Dawn of Ragnarok will launch on March 10 for PS5, Xbox Series X/S, PS4, Xbox One, PC, and Stadia.
